His commitment to genetic awareness is deeply personal—after losing his daughter, Havi, to Tay-Sachs disease in 2021, he became a passionate advocate for proactive testing and prevention.
Through JScreen, Dr. Goldstein honors Havi’s legacy by helping families make informed health decisions, most recently leading the record-breaking Pink Power Hour event with NBC’s TODAY Show, Mount Sinai Cancer Center, and Myriad Genetics.
